Oakland historian and activist Dr. Xavier Buck joins the show for a deep conversation about the true legacy of the Black Panther Party, the political education that shaped him, and why the movement’s lessons still matter today. Plus, the legacy of the civil rights movement and whether athletes are heeding the lessons of their previous generations.
